@@ -1395,17 +1395,13 @@ Instruction *InstCombiner::visitPtrToInt(PtrToIntInst &CI) {
// If the destination integer type is not the intptr_t type for this target,
// do a ptrtoint to intptr_t then do a trunc or zext. This allows the cast
// to be exposed to other transforms.
- if (TD) {
- if (CI.getType()->getScalarSizeInBits() < TD->getPointerSizeInBits()) {
- Value *P = Builder->CreatePtrToInt(CI.getOperand(0),
- TD->getIntPtrType(CI.getContext()));
- return new TruncInst(P, CI.getType());
- }
- if (CI.getType()->getScalarSizeInBits() > TD->getPointerSizeInBits()) {
- Value *P = Builder->CreatePtrToInt(CI.getOperand(0),
- TD->getIntPtrType(CI.getContext()));
- return new ZExtInst(P, CI.getType());
- }
+ if (TD && CI.getType()->getScalarSizeInBits() != TD->getPointerSizeInBits()) {
+ Type *Ty = TD->getIntPtrType(CI.getContext());
+ if (CI.getType()->isVectorTy()) // Handle vectors of pointers.
+ Ty = VectorType::get(Ty, CI.getType()->getVectorNumElements());
+
+ Value *P = Builder->CreatePtrToInt(CI.getOperand(0), Ty);
+ return CastInst::CreateIntegerCast(P, CI.getType(), /*isSigned=*/false);
}
return commonPointerCastTransforms(CI);
